Safety Information

To reduce the risk of fire, electric shock, or injury, always follow basic safety precautions when using this appliance.

  • Ensure the appliance is connected to a properly grounded electrical outlet.
  • Do not immerse the appliance, cord, or plug in water or other liquids.
  • Keep children away from the hot water dispenser to prevent burns. The hot water spout is equipped with a child safety lock.
  • Do not operate the appliance with a damaged cord or plug.
  • Place the appliance on a firm, level surface, away from direct sunlight and heat sources.
  • Allow adequate ventilation around the appliance. Maintain at least 4 inches (10 cm) of space from walls.
  • Only use 3 or 5-gallon water bottles with this dispenser.

Setup Instructions

1. Unpacking and Placement

Carefully remove the dispenser from its packaging. Place the unit upright on a flat, stable, and level surface. Ensure the area is well-ventilated and away from direct heat or sunlight. Allow the unit to stand upright for at least 2 hours before plugging it in to allow the compressor fluids to settle.

2. Initial Cleaning

Before first use, clean the water tanks and lines. Dispense and discard at least 1 liter of water from each spout (hot, cold, room temperature) to flush the system. For the ice maker, run one or two ice-making cycles and discard the ice produced.

3. Installing the Water Bottle

Remove the protective seal from the top of a new 3 or 5-gallon water bottle. Lift the bottle and carefully place it onto the top-loading support collar of the dispenser. Ensure the bottle is seated firmly and water begins to flow into the internal reservoir.

4. Power Connection

Once the water bottle is installed and the unit has settled, plug the power cord into a grounded electrical outlet. The indicator lights on the control panel will illuminate.

Operating Instructions

1. Water Dispensing

The dispenser features a touch control panel for water selection. Allow approximately 15-20 minutes for the hot and cold water to reach their optimal temperatures after initial power-on.

  • Hot Water: Press the 'Hot' button. For safety, the hot water spout has a child safety lock. Press and hold the safety lock button while pressing the 'Hot' button to dispense hot water (up to 198°F / 92°C).
  • Cold Water: Press the 'Cold' button to dispense cold water (down to 49°F / 9°C).
  • Room Temperature Water: Press the 'Room Temp' button to dispense water at ambient temperature.

2. Ice Making Function

The built-in ice maker produces bullet-shaped ice. Ensure the water reservoir is filled for ice production.

  • Start Ice Production: Press the 'Ice' button on the control panel. The ice indicator light will illuminate.
  • Ice Production Cycle: Each cycle produces 9 bullet ice pieces in approximately 6-10 minutes.
  • Ice Storage: The ice maker can produce up to 26 lbs of ice per day. The ice is stored in the lower compartment. Note that this compartment is not a freezer and ice will melt over time if not used.

Maintenance

Regular cleaning and maintenance ensure optimal performance and longevity of your dispenser.

1. Exterior Cleaning

Wipe the exterior surfaces with a soft, damp cloth. Do not use abrasive cleaners or solvents.

2. Drip Tray Cleaning

The drip tray should be emptied and cleaned regularly to prevent overflow and bacterial growth. Pull out the drip tray, empty any collected water, wash with mild soap and water, rinse thoroughly, and replace.

3. Internal Cleaning and Descaling

Periodically, the internal water tanks and lines should be cleaned and descaled. Unplug the unit and drain all water from the hot and cold tanks using the drain plugs located at the back of the unit. A solution of water and white vinegar (1:1 ratio) can be used to flush the system. Allow the solution to sit for 30 minutes, then drain and rinse thoroughly with fresh water several times.

4. Ice Maker Cleaning

Clean the ice maker compartment and ice scoop with a mild detergent and water. Rinse thoroughly and ensure all parts are dry before reassembly. Do not use harsh chemicals.

Troubleshooting Guide

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
No water dispensingWater bottle empty or not properly seated. Air lock in the system.Replace water bottle. Re-seat bottle firmly. Prime the system by pressing spouts until water flows.
Water not hot/cold enoughHeating/cooling switch off. Unit recently plugged in. Poor ventilation.Ensure heating/cooling switches (if present, usually at the back) are on. Allow 15-20 minutes for temperature stabilization. Ensure adequate space around the unit.
No ice productionWater reservoir empty. Ice maker switch off. Ambient temperature too high.Ensure water bottle is full and water is flowing to the ice maker. Press the 'Ice' button. Ensure unit is in a suitable environment.
Water leakageWater bottle cracked or improperly seated. Drain plugs loose.Check water bottle for cracks and proper seating. Tighten drain plugs at the back of the unit.
